psychological warfare
uncountable noun: Psychological warfare consists of attempts to make your enemy lose confidence, give up hope, or feel afraid, so that you can win. psychological warfare in American English the use of propaganda or other psychological means to influence or confuse the thinking, undermine the morale, etc. of an enemy or opponent noun: the use of propaganda, threats, and other psychological techniques to mislead, intimidate, demoralize, or otherwise influence the thinking or behavior of an opponent psychological warfare in British English noun: the military application of psychology, esp to propaganda and attempts to influence the morale of enemy and friendly groups in time of war |
